Course Description:

This session explores the Short and Long-Stay Pressure Ulcer/Injury Quality Measures, including definitions, measure logic specifications, and how pressure ulcer development impacts quality outcomes, Five-Star ratings, and survey risk. Participants will review MDS coding requirements, common documentation pitfalls, and the relationship between assessment accuracy, care planning, and quality measure performance. Best-practice strategies will be shared to support prevention, early identification, and compliance across the interdisciplinary team.

Learning Objectives

1. Explain the Short and Long-Stay Pressure Ulcer Quality Measures

2. Apply accurate MDS coding and assessment principles related to pressure ulcer staging, timing, and documentation.

3. Describe the relationship between assessment accuracy, care planning, and pressure ulcer prevention strategies.
